- 1、本文档共28页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
目录
摘要1
第一章概述2
1。1交通灯的发展及现状2
1。2单片机说明2
第二章智能交通灯的设计原理5
2。1智能交通灯的设计框图5
2.2智能交通灯的设计方案及改进措施5
第三章智能交通灯电路设计5
3。1控制器的系统框图6
3。2智能交通灯控制系统电路图错误!未定义书签。
3。3工作原理7
第四章智能交通灯软件系统设计13
4.1智能交通灯的软件设计流程图13
4。2程序源代码13
第五章智能交通灯方案的仿真13
小结18
致谢词18
参考文献18
附录20
附录A:智能交通灯控制程序:20
0
摘要
本文介绍的是一个基于PROTEUS的智能交通灯控制系统的设计与仿真,系统
根据交通十字路口双车道车流量的情况控制交通信号灯按特定的规律变化。
本文首先对智能交通灯的研究意义和智能交通灯的研究现状进行了分析,指
出了现状交通灯存在的缺点,并提出了改进方法.智能交通灯控制系统通常要实
现自动控制和在紧急情况下能够手动切换信号灯让特殊车辆优先通行。本文还对
AT89S51单片机的结构特点和重要引脚功能进行了介绍,同时对智能交通灯控制
系统的设计进行了详细的分析.最后利用PROTEUS软件,通过其平台对交通灯控
制系统进行了仿真,仿真结果表明系统工作性能良好.
关键词:PROTEUS、AT89S51单片机、智能交通灯;
1
第一章概述
1.1交通灯的发展及现状
中国车辆数量不断增加,交通管制的工作量越来越大,利用计算机代替人进
行高效交通管理是必然的发展趋势,而让计算机控制的交通灯拥有类似人类的感
知智能,具有很强的现实意义,比如通过摄像机让交通灯控制系统获得视觉感知
功能,就可以代替人类的眼睛,使系统根据所“看到功能,就可以代替人类的眼睛,使系统根据所“看到交通情况自适应改变管制
策略,提高了交通管理的自动化水平,使得交通更高效、更顺畅。
目前设计交通灯的方案有很多,有应用CPLD设计实现交通信号灯控制器方
法;有应用PLC实现对交通灯控制系统的设计;有应用单片机实现对交通信号灯
设计的方法。目前,国内的交通灯一般设在十字路门,在醒目位置用红、绿、黄三
种颜色的指示灯。加上一个倒计时的显示计时器来控制行车。对于一般情况下的
安全行车,车辆分流尚能发挥作用,但根据实际行车过程中出现的情况,还存在
以下缺点:1.两车道的车辆轮流放行时间相同且固定,在十字路口,经常一个
车道为主干道,车辆较多,放行时间应该长些;另一车道为副干道,车辆较少,放
行时间应该短些。2.没有考虑紧急车通过时,两车道应采取的措施,臂如,消防
车执行紧急任务通过时,两车道的车都应停止,让紧急车通过。
1.2单片机说明
按照单片机系统扩展与系统配置状况,单片机应用系统可分为最小系
统、最小功耗系统及典型系统等.AT89C51单片机是美国ATMEL公司生产的
低电压、高性能CMOS8位单片机,具有丰富的内部资源:4kB闪存、128BRAM、
32根I/O口线、2个16位定时/计数器、5个向量两级中断结构、2个全双
工的串行口,具有4.25~5.50V的电压工作范围和0~24MHz工作频率,使
用AT89C51单片机时无须外扩存储器。因此,本流水灯实际上就是一个带
有八个发光二极管的单片机最小应用系统,即为由发光二极管、晶振、复位、
电源等电路和必要的软件组成的单个单片机。
2
1。2。1AT89C51单片机硬件结构
AT89C51是一种带4K字节闪存可编程可擦除只读存储器(FPEROM-Flash
ProgrammableandErasableReadOnlyMemory)的单片机芯片,它采用静态
CMOS工艺制造8位微处理器,最高工作频率位24MHZ。AT89C5外形及引
文档评论(0)